Financing and Loan Considerations
Purchasers should anticipate that banks typically offer loan-to-value (LTV) ratios of 75% to 80% for properties in prime residential locations such as Orchard. At an illustrative purchase price of S$6.3 million, this implies a down payment requirement of S$1.26 million to S$1.575 million. Total debt servicing costs, inclusive of property tax and insurance, should not exceed 30% of gross household income under current banking guidelines—a threshold known as the Total Debt Servicing Ratio (TDSR). Prospective buyers are advised to engage with financial institutions early to confirm borrowing capacity at their specific price point.
Stamp Duty and Tax Implications
First-time property buyers enjoy exemption from Additional Buyer's Stamp Duty (ABSD). However, Singapore Citizens purchasing a second residential property face an ABSD rate of 20%, applied on top of the standard Buyer's Stamp Duty. Investors or upgraders with existing residential property should factor this 20% ABSD levy into their acquisition costs. For a S$6.3 million purchase, 20% ABSD equates to S$1.26 million, a material consideration in investment decision-making. Purchasers are strongly encouraged to seek professional tax and legal advice prior to commitment.
